Output 1e650b5e3057204665a41169d2c2a056e4e4e47fd3c9ed8094d2279e68ad1c3f:1

value
4495646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e33d316f9370c85ebdb952e449e2f1796b7ebf OP_EQUAL
address
3BFcRLd1SQMhgau1M5t5wyazce3HDY89MW
transaction
1e650b5e3057204665a41169d2c2a056e4e4e47fd3c9ed8094d2279e68ad1c3f
confirmations
322292
spent
true